Traumatic Brain Injury Leaves Denver Woman in Critical Condition After Violent Mugging

A Denver woman, Scherrie Henderson, is fighting for her life after being brutally assaulted and robbed in downtown Denver. The attack occurred near the intersection of 22nd Street and Curtis Street on Oct. 13. Scherrie, a mother of three, was found unconscious by a passerby and rushed to Denver Health with severe injuries. Her sister, Daina Daniels, shared that Scherrie suffered a traumatic brain injury and has not woken up since the incident.

“Scherrie is very outgoing and makes friends wherever she goes,” Daniels said, adding that the hardest part is not knowing what her sister’s recovery will look like. The family believes she was assaulted and robbed, as her purse was found empty at the scene.

The Denver Police Department is investigating the attack, but no arrests have been made. Henderson’s family has started a GoFundMe to help with medical costs as they face an uncertain future.
